what is the HCF of 3000 and 525 answer with process
Answer:
The HCF is 75
Step-by-step explanation:
Here, we want to get the highest common factors of the two numbers
To do this, we have to write the numbers as the product of their prime factors
We have;
3,000 = 2 * 2 * 2 * 3 * 5 * 5 * 5
525 = 3 * 5 * 5 * 7
now looking at this, we can see that in both numbers, we can have 3 * 5 * 5 taken out as it is common to both numbers
This represents the highest common factor of the two numbers
and that is 75

The mean age of 11 women in an office is 31 years old.
The mean age of 6 men in an office is 29 years old.
What is the mean age (nearest year) of all the people in the office?

Answer:
30
Step-by-step explanation:
The total of the ages of the 11 women is 11·31 = 341. The total of the ages of the 6 men is 6·29 = 174. Then the total of the ages of all 17 people in the office is ...
341 + 174 = 515
and their average age is ...
515/17 ≈ 30.294 ≈ 30
The mean age of the people in the office, to the nearest year, is 30.
_____
The mean is the total divided by the number of contributors. Then the total is the mean times the number of contributors.
